Abstract
Several points regarding cylindrical Brans-Dicke geometries are studied. The issue of particle trajectories for the vacuum cylindrical solution is revisited. The possible particular nature of a global string metric is analysed. The general form of the junction conditions for matching cylindrical solutions within this theory is written down, and the relation with the general relativity limit is discussed.
